Full Job Description

## Description The Director of Case owns the end-to-end development of SCMC’s case deliverables and competition materials. This role ensures the case is rigorous, well-scoped, and professionally packaged, with clean exhibits, rules, and evaluation tools that allow competitors and judges to perform at a high level.   ## Time Commitment 10 hours/week (more during peak deadlines and competition weeks) ## Term of Employment June 2026 – March 2027 ## Main Responsibilities Lead case creation: prompt design, exhibits/data room, clarifications process, and version control Build competition rules and regulations and ensure consistency across all public-facing materials Design the scoring system: rubric, marking sheets, and judge guidance (including calibration) Coordinate with Competition + Conference teams on timelines, deliverables, and day-of execution Maintain quality control for all case-facing outputs (formatting, accuracy, completeness, fairness) Benchmark comparable competitions and incorporate improvements year-over-year ## Qualifications Strong writing + structuring instincts (clear problem statements, clean assumptions, tight scope) Interest in valuation / modeling and transaction reasoning (DCF, comps, deal logic) Extremely detail-oriented and able to manage complex deliverables under deadlines Comfortable leading a team and holding high standards Experience in Capital Markets/Banking ## Anticipated Learning Outcomes Direct experience building a national-level case competition deliverable Stronger analytical, presentation, and professional communication skills Stakeholder management with judges and finance professionals ## Additional Information Submit the following no later than June 17th at 11:59 PM PST: 1. A one-page resume highlighting your most relevant experiences 2. Cover Letter (Optional)
